Service Technician Plant Construction (m/f/d)
Role:
As a Service Technician, you are responsible for the reliable commissioning, maintenance, and technical support of modern systems at the customer’s site. You ensure the flawless functioning of the systems, analyse faults, and independently carry out repairs and optimisations. With your customer-oriented approach, you competently support users on site and make an important contribution to high system availability.
Responsibilities:
Independent commissioning and functional testing of systems at the customer’s site
Ensuring reliable and trouble-free operational readiness of technical systems
Analysis, localisation, and rectification of faults and technical errors
Carrying out planned maintenance work, repairs, and service calls
Inspection of system components and implementation of necessary adjustments and improvements
Competent advice and support for customers on technical issues
Documentation of completed work and feedback of relevant information
Taking on on-call duties on a regular rotation (approx. every 8 weeks)
Support in optimising system processes and technical procedures
Qualifications:
Completed technical basic training, for example as a heating installer, sanitary installer, agricultural machinery mechanic, automotive technician, mechanic, electrical fitter, locksmith, or comparable
Basic understanding in the field of electrical engineering and electrical installations
Strong manual skills and enjoyment of practical technical work
Experience with water hydraulics and knowledge of welding advantageous
Confident handling of technical systems and willingness to familiarise yourself with new systems
Independent, precise, and responsible working style
Customer-oriented personality with good manners and enjoyment of direct contact
High service orientation and strong team spirit
Driving licence Category B
Fluent German skills
